首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

香港加速cdn

基础概念

CDN(Content Delivery Network)即内容分发网络,是一种分布式网络架构,通过在全球各地部署边缘节点服务器,将网站内容缓存到这些节点上,使用户能够就近获取所需内容,从而提高访问速度和用户体验。

优势

  1. 提高访问速度:用户可以从最近的节点获取内容,减少网络传输延迟。
  2. 增强网站稳定性:通过负载均衡和故障转移机制,提高网站的可用性和稳定性。
  3. 节省带宽成本:CDN可以分担源站的带宽压力,降低网站的运营成本。
  4. 提升安全性:CDN可以提供一定的DDoS攻击防护和安全加速功能。

类型

  1. 通用型CDN:适用于大多数网站和应用,提供基本的加速服务。
  2. 视频CDN:针对视频内容进行优化,提供流畅的视频播放体验。
  3. 下载型CDN:针对大文件下载场景,提供高速稳定的下载服务。
  4. 全站加速CDN:针对整个网站进行优化,包括网页、图片、视频等多种内容类型。

应用场景

  1. 电商网站:提高商品展示和交易页面的加载速度,提升用户购物体验。
  2. 新闻媒体:快速发布和传播新闻内容,满足用户的即时阅读需求。
  3. 在线教育:保障视频课程的流畅播放,提高教学效果。
  4. 游戏行业:减少游戏加载时间和卡顿现象,提升玩家的游戏体验。

遇到的问题及解决方法

问题1:CDN加速效果不明显

原因

  1. 源站服务器性能不足,导致CDN节点无法获取到最新的内容。
  2. CDN节点配置不当,未能有效缓存网站内容。
  3. 用户的网络环境较差,影响了CDN加速效果。

解决方法

  1. 优化源站服务器性能,确保CDN节点能够及时获取最新内容。
  2. 调整CDN节点配置,增加缓存策略和缓存时间。
  3. 提升用户的网络环境,例如使用更稳定的网络连接或升级宽带。

问题2:CDN出现安全问题

原因

  1. CDN节点被恶意攻击,导致服务中断或数据泄露。
  2. 源站存在安全漏洞,被黑客利用进行攻击。

解决方法

  1. 加强CDN节点的安全防护,定期进行安全检查和漏洞修复。
  2. 对源站进行安全加固,包括使用HTTPS加密传输、限制访问权限等措施。
  3. 配置防火墙和入侵检测系统,及时发现并应对安全威胁。

示例代码(前端使用CDN加速)

代码语言:txt
复制
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>CDN加速示例</title>
    <!-- 引入jQuery库 -->
    <script src="https://cdn.jsdelivr.net/npm/jquery@3.6.0/dist/jquery.min.js"></script>
</head>
<body>
    <h1>CDN加速示例</h1>
    <button id="btn">点击我</button>
    <script>
        $(document).ready(function() {
            $('#btn').click(function() {
                alert('Hello, CDN!');
            });
        });
    </script>
</body>
</html>

在这个示例中,我们使用了CDN加速来引入jQuery库,从而加快页面加载速度。

参考链接

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券